Identification of halophile bacteria from salt deserts of Iran and study some of their physiological traits

Abstract:
Introduction
Halophiles and Halotolerant microorganisms are some of the extremophiles that are able to grow in medium containing sodium chloride and have dapted to life in salinity environments. Halophiles bacteria in saline soils by maintaining the food chain, decomposition of organic matter and improvement of soil structure and fertility improve soil conditions.
Materials And Methods
In order to isolate the halotoletant bacteria, from the Halophyte rhizosphere, four desert areas in Golestan province were sampled. To check the Extremophile of isolates, their resistance was tested for resistant to salinity, drought, temperature and PH. Also, plant growth promoting traits were measured.
Results
Fromforty-five strains which were isolated, three strains (G3, G6 and G14) have demonstrated the ability of resistance to 35% salt. Isolates G6 and G3 phosphate solubiliziation power of 301 and 201 ppm, respectively. Isolated G6 micrograms produced auxin 20/7 Mg/ ml. G14 and G6 grow at 50 °C, pH = 10 and osmotic potential -0 /7MPa. While G3 strain grows at 50 °C, pH = 7/ 5 and osmotic potential -0 /49. The three strains of the bacterial genera Bacillus and Pseudomonas, respectively.
Discussion and
Conclusion
In this study, isolates due to the growth in concentrations of salt and saturated salt tolerance of extreme environmental conditions and are likely halotolerant or halophile bacteria and its potential for use in various fields of biotechnology including biotech, industrial enzyme production and biological fertilizers for saline soil improvement.
